As one of the organisations involved in the initial consultation, we are pleased to see this feasibility study being launched by Co-operative Futures
We are excited to launch this feasibility study into local #socialinvestment in #Oxfordshire. We know that early stage #socialenterprises are often under-capitalised but how do we bridge the finance gap and create a more #inclusiveeconomy? We outline a roadmap to create a local social investment fund that makes finance more accessible and priorities #socialreturn. October's Member Spotlight highlights the excellent work of OXPIP. The Oxford Parent-Infant Project (OXPIP) provides essential support to new parents and their infants throughout Oxfordshire, helping families during the crucial early stages of parenthood. OXPIP specialises in early intervention, offering therapeutic services from conception up to the child’s second birthday, focusing on strengthening the bond between parent and child.
